Take action - prevent yourself from becoming a victim of mail theft.

You can avoid becoming a mail theft victim by following these tips:

- Don't leave outgoing mail in an unlocked box. Take it to the post office or a retail mail service store.

- If you don't have a choice but to leave outgoing mail in your mailbox, place the items in the box immediately before the letter carrier arrives.

- Never raise the mailbox flag. The red flag sticking up is an open invitation to a thief.

- Avoid leaving mail out in your mailbox on Sundays and holidays, when letter carriers don't provide services.

- Consider replacing your current mailbox with one that has a locking device.

- Arrange to pick up newly ordered checks at the bank instead of receiving them by mail.

- Use gel pens to write and sign checks. The ink in gel pens is resistant to chemicals used in check washing.

- Check bank statements frequently.

- Have a trusted friend or neighbor pick up your mail when you are out of town.

- Remember to always shred your personal documents and credit cards before discarding them.
